While natural breeding is the traditional method, modern donkey breeding has increasingly adopted artificial insemination (AI) for several strategic reasons. AI allows for more careful genetic selection, facilitates the use of frozen or cooled semen from valuable jacks anywhere in the world, and can be more manageable for animal handlers [4†L7-L10].
